Ndictionary in python pdf books

Contribute to junnplusawesome pythonbooks development by creating an account on github. I have checked the contents of c and python book, and i can say these are quality books. This book is designed to show you how to use python in combination with the raw processing power of your computer to accomplish realworld tasks in a more efficient way. A collection of python books contribute to abanandpy books development by creating an account on github. For example, 4 of the books focus on writing python games. The best intermediate and advanced python books provide insight to help you level up your python skills, enabling you to become an expert pythonista. If you do not have any prior knowledge of programming. Python is very popular in scientific fields, so a smattering of scientific focused titles are presented too. Python dictionary dictionary in python is an unordered collection of data values, used to store data values like a map, which unlike other data types that hold only single value as an element, dictionary holds key. Iwas almost100%sureaboutthereasonwhytheendproductwasamuch. Want a book on the django web framework that doesnt leave anything out.

Python is a popular programming language used for a variety purposes from web development and software automation to machine learning. This section contains free e books and guides on python, some of the resources in this section can be viewed online and some of them can be downloaded. As of today we have 77,375,193 ebooks for you to download for free. A dictionary is a collection which is unordered, changeable and indexed. Beginning python, advanced python, and python exercises author. Python programming for the absolute beginners download book. This manual describes how to install and configure mysql connector python, a selfcontained python driver for communicating with mysql servers, and how to use it to develop database applications. Python for unix and linux system administration python is an ideal language for solving problems, especially for linux and unix. It teaches an absolute beginner to harness the power of python and program computers to do tasks in seconds that would normally take hours to d. Dictionaries allow us to do fast databaselike operations in python. Python has a fully dynamic type system and uses automatic memory management.

Pdf pdf cambridge igcse and o level computer science. And given that the books have a similar writing style, they should be able to move quickly through think python with a minimum of e. Share this article with your classmates and friends so that they can also follow latest study materials and notes on engineering subjects. Jul 03, 2017 python crash course is a fastpaced, thorough introduction to programming with python that will have you writing programs, solving problems, and making things that work in no time. The appendixes provide a quick info to the first choices of the python language, along with additional guides to nonnecessary strategies such as a result of the idle enchancment setting and customary ideas for migrating from one different language. Most new python programmers dont realise that there are great python books out there for free and due to their lack of knowledge they pay for expensive ones. Python includes the following dictionary functions. All of the books are released under an open source license. In 2003 i started teaching at olin college and i got to teach python for the. This would be equal to the number of items in the dictionary. One you know comes from an authoritative source that you can trust to give you the good stuff. This short cut is taken from programming in python 3. Createmodifyreuse is designed for all levels of python developers interested in a practical, handson way of learning python development.

The globals function returns all the globals variables in the current environment. Contribute to revolunetpythonbooks development by creating an account on github. Sn function with description 1 cmpdict1,dict2 compares elements of both dict. Assignment creates references, not copies names in python do not have an intrinsic type. The python notes for professionals book is compiled from stack overflow documentation, the content is written by the beautiful people at stack overflow. If you are a beginner, intermediate or even an advanced programmer there is something for you in this book. Python determines the type of the reference automatically based on the data object assigned to it. Dictionary literals use curly braces and have a list of key. External sources of information about python books. December27,2015 onthe28thofapril2012thecontentsoftheenglishaswellasgermanwikibooksandwikipedia projectswerelicensedundercreativecommonsattributionsharealike3. Binding a variable in python means setting a name to hold a reference to some object. The book is recommended for experienced python program who wants to learn modern tools use for python development. Pdf cambridge igcse and o level computer science programming book for python cambridge internatio. We have fed all above signals to a trained ranking ml algorithm to score and rank books based on their quality.

However, you have to explicitly declare a variable as globalto modify it. Python stores the variables we use as a dictionary. Scalar values however are usually insufficient to deal with current data. This book is an outcome of my desire to have something like this when i was beginning to learn python. I first heard about your book from a coworker who wanted to trickmewithyourexampleofhowdictionariesarebuilt. With the personal touch of a skilled teacher, she beautifully balances details of the language with the insights and advice you need to handle any task. Everything you need to know to get started with the best data structure. Python is a powerful highlevel open source programming language that is available for. To tap into the power of pythons open data science stack including numpy, pandas, matplotlib, scikitlearn, and other tools you first need to understand the syntax, semantics, and patterns of the python language.

Python for unified research in econometrics and statistics. Think python green tea press free books by allen b. Getting started with python language, python data types, indentation, comments and documentation. Please feel free to share this pdf with anyone for free, latest version. Recipes for mastering python 3 python cookbook is an ideal book if you need help writing programs in python 3.

Python is an objectoriented highlevel programming language created by guido van rossum in 1990. This is an uno cial free book created for educational purposes and is not a liated with o cial. Suppose you have a python program that read in a whole page from a book into. Please note that this book is not a tutorial and does not teach you python. According to yasoob, most of these books have the same high quality material which you would expect from a paid book, so theyre definitely belong to a group of resources which worth checking out. The comprehensive guide to building network applications with python books for professionals by professionals publication date. Most of the techniques covered arenot needed every day, but in the right circumstances they can make a crucialdifference, allowing us to write clean and. Dive into python is a free python book for experienced programmers. Top python books for this post, we have scraped various signals e. In python dictionaries are written with curly brackets, and they have keys and values. The programming language used in this book is python 1 version 2. If you are fluent in any programming language, this might be very easy for you. A complete introduction to the python language addisonwesley, 2009 and provides selfcontainedcoverage of pythons advanced features.

Handsdown one of the best books for learning python. May 25, 2016 watchstar python monthly top 10 on github and get notified once a month. It may not be as applicable, but i just cracked open programming in python 3 by mark summerfield and so far it seems pretty good, although it is focused on python 3, so if youre planning on learning something like django, which hasnt made the jump to python 3 and likely wont for some time, this book might not be the best. Python dictionaries chapter 9 python for informatics. The quick python book, third edition is a comprehensive guide to the python language by a python authority, naomi ceder. Pythonbooks showcase the bests free ebooks about the python programming language. This course is probably unsuitable for those with programming experience, even if it is just in shell scripting or matlab like programs. We provided the download links to python programming books pdf download b. It is very is to learn and you can write simple program in some couple of days. Free python books download ebooks online textbooks tutorials. If you give a key however that is not in the dictionary, python will output an. Search the worlds most comprehensive index of fulltext books.

Compiled by yasoob at freepythontips, here are 49 free python ebooks. This book is designed for people with absolutely no experience of programming. A collection of python books featuring popularity based ranking. Contribute to junnplusawesomepythonbooks development by creating an account on github. Check out the best python books for kids for resources aimed at a younger audience. As you progress in you python journey, you will want to dig deeper to maximize the efficiency of your code. He sent me a copy of his translation, and i had the unusual experience of learning python by reading my own book. Fortunately, python thinks that laziness is a virtue, and would never tolerate that. In this observation, we compared nearly 750 ebooks related to python programming language and sized the number down to 20. Higher order organization of data in the previous chapter, we have seen the concept of scalar variables that define memory space in which we store a scalar, i.

629 1006 803 529 47 403 1543 582 389 1531 1219 141 1455 749 329 1258 1316 1265 752 443 449 841 1034 820 717 1113 1271 391 1290 214 1499 465 1438 212 409 238 1104 327 1581 1033 1135 1285 281 1072 145 1145 1476 160 970 977